Предмет: Информатика,
автор: sh1999
Даны две последовательности а1, а2,...аn и b1, b2..bm. (m<n). В каждой из них числа различны. Верно ли, что все числа второй последовательности входят в первую.
Решить в Паскале, с помощью одномерных массивов
amikk:
а что найти т0?
Ответы
Автор ответа:
0
const n = 100;
const m = 50;
var a:array[1..n] of integer;
b:array[1..n] of integer;
i,it,bo:integer;
begin
for i:= 1 to n do
a[i] := trunc(Random(100));
for i:= 1 to m do
b[i] := trunc(Random(100));
bo:=1;
for i:=1 to m do
if bo = 1 then
for it:=1 to n do
if b[i] <> a[it] then begin bo:= 0; break; end;
if bo = 1 then write('Входят') else write('Не входят');
end.
если я правильно понял задание то так
const m = 50;
var a:array[1..n] of integer;
b:array[1..n] of integer;
i,it,bo:integer;
begin
for i:= 1 to n do
a[i] := trunc(Random(100));
for i:= 1 to m do
b[i] := trunc(Random(100));
bo:=1;
for i:=1 to m do
if bo = 1 then
for it:=1 to n do
if b[i] <> a[it] then begin bo:= 0; break; end;
if bo = 1 then write('Входят') else write('Не входят');
end.
если я правильно понял задание то так
Похожие вопросы
Предмет: Окружающий мир,
автор: samarinakarina6
Предмет: Русский язык,
автор: aslol94ozgnrr
Предмет: Окружающий мир,
автор: oomnick1
Предмет: Музыка,
автор: NaGibAtoRg2w
Предмет: Русский язык,
автор: polinaaldop6b304